The home should be thoroughly … great lakes coloring sheetWebb1 sep. 2024 · A Form N4 is not invalid simply because the landlord holds a rent deposit that is greater than the rent owing. The rent deposit can only be applied to the last month of the tenancy. Therefore, the landlord should not apply the deposit to the rent arrears before applying to evict the tenant. floating tray frameWebb16 juli 2024 · It is the landlord’s responsibility to ensure that acceptable standards are maintained throughout the duration of the tenancy.
